Loadiine is a homebrew application for the Wii U. Originally developed for consoles on lower firmware versions (such as 5.3.2), it functions as a "backup loader," enabling the console to read game files directly from an SD card. Unlike standard game installations that require a USB drive or the console's internal storage, Loadiine relies on a specific folder structure and file format.
